The LT6411IUD#PBF is a high-speed, low-power differential amplifier integrated circuit chip manufactured by Analog Devices. It offers several advantages and can be applied in various scenarios. Some of the advantages and application scenarios of the LT6411IUD#PBF are:Advantages: 1. High-Speed Performance: The LT6411IUD#PBF is designed to operate at high speeds, making it suitable for applications that require fast signal amplification and processing.2. Low Power Consumption: This integrated circuit chip is designed to consume low power, making it suitable for battery-powered devices or applications where power efficiency is crucial.3. Wide Input Voltage Range: The LT6411IUD#PBF can handle a wide range of input voltages, allowing it to be used in various signal amplification applications.4. Differential Amplification: This chip is specifically designed for differential amplification, which is useful in applications where the difference between two input signals needs to be amplified while rejecting common-mode noise.5. Small Form Factor: The LT6411IUD#PBF is available in a small form factor package, making it suitable for space-constrained applications or designs where size is a critical factor.Application Scenarios: 1. Communication Systems: The LT6411IUD#PBF can be used in communication systems, such as high-speed data transmission, optical communication, or wireless communication, where it can amplify differential signals and reject common-mode noise.2. Instrumentation and Measurement: This integrated circuit chip can be used in instrumentation and measurement applications, such as oscilloscopes or data acquisition systems, where it can amplify small differential signals accurately.3. Video and Imaging Systems: The LT6411IUD#PBF can be used in video and imaging systems, such as high-definition cameras or video processing equipment, where it can amplify differential video signals with high speed and low power consumption.4. Industrial Control Systems: This chip can be used in industrial control systems, such as motor control or robotics, where it can amplify differential sensor signals or control signals accurately.5. Medical Equipment: The LT6411IUD#PBF can be used in medical equipment, such as patient monitoring systems or medical imaging devices, where it can amplify differential signals from sensors or imaging sensors with high precision.Overall, the LT6411IUD#PBF integrated circuit chip offers high-speed, low-power, and differential amplification capabilities, making it suitable for a wide range of applications in various industries.
